Tech Solutions: How a Start-up is Changing the Game in HIV Prevention
Innovate Calgary and UCeed
Date: Wednesday, Sept. 8, 2021
Time: 12 p.m.
UCeed company, Freddie, will discuss how their online service offering HIV PrEP, has been working to erase healthcare barriers for LGBTQ2S+ communities through virtual healthcare solutions. Freddie represents an effort to innovate and work towards more equitable sexual health services in Canada.
